all correct
English
Phrase
- (colloquial, obsolete) true; agreed, yes indeed
- (colloquial, obsolete) in order; properly arranged; as expected; above reproach; shipshape
- in particular:
- (of accounts, amounts, or calculations) accurate, tallied correctly
- (of documents, especially legal documents) accurate and appropriate
